AI’s “Hallucinations” as Modern Thought Experiments
Artificial intelligence, when trained on vast libraries of human knowledge, mirrors the creative processes of these human pioneers. Models can fuse disparate ideas, dream up novel scenarios, and propose hypotheses that no single researcher might consider. When a neural network generates a bizarre yet intriguing “hallucination,” it performs a large-scale thought experiment.
Rather than dismissing these machine-born visions, we should treat them as provocations: invitations to test, refine, and challenge. In other words, AI’s creative stumbles can seed genuine innovation if we know how to interrogate them.

When Minds Go on Auto-Pilot: The Terrible Cost of Ceding Creativity to AI
There is an enormous and unprecedented opportunity in this new collaboration, but also a grave risk if we leave the work to the models. If we let AI tackle every question, innovation cracks under our feet. Like a community that forgets its mother tongue, a society that hands over thinking to algorithms will see its critical analysis, pattern-recognition, and problem-solving muscles atrophy. Tasks once effortless – spotting hidden connections, crafting metaphors, questioning assumptions – become foreign as we slip into passive consumers of AI’s polished outputs, rather than active co-creators carving new frontiers. We become utterly dispensable.
Over time, three forces conspire to hollow out human intellect.
- Cognitive atrophy: Relying on AI as our sole “calculator” shrinks working memory and mental agility.
- Loss of intellectual ownership: If AI designs, argues, and refutes our theories end-to-end, we lose the confidence and responsibility that fuel genuine breakthroughs.
- Ethical stagnation: When models decree the “best” solutions, public debate flattens into echo chambers of algorithmic consensus, leaving blind spots unexamined.
